Coach Arthur Elias promises more tests in the women’s team until the end of the year

The national team has four more games, all friendly, until the end of the year

Coach Arthur Elias promised to carry out more tests on the Brazilian women’s football team until the end of 2024, with an eye on renewing the team for the coming years, with a focus on the 2027 World Cup. The national team has four more games, all friendlies until the end of the year.

“In this call and in the next, the objective will be to observe more the players who may not have participated in my process with the selection, others who participated in a smaller volume and also to continue with the group that was successful in the Olympics. Always with great criteria, drafting call-up by call-up. We want to increase the range, bring experience to a larger group of players in the selection”, he stated.

In the current call-up, made this month, the coach called only 12 players who were in the Paris-2024 Olympic campaign. In total, he called up 26 athletes for the friendlies with Colombia, next Saturday, the 26th, and next Tuesday, the 29th, at the Kleber Andrade stadium, in Cariacica (ES).

Later this year, Arthur Elias will make another call-up, for the November friendlies. After that, the coach will finish testing and begin forming the team for the Copa América, in 2025.

“In the squads prior to the Copa América, when the focus is on winning the competition, we are preparing for the 2027 World Cup. We prepared very well for the Olympics, then we had a good result there. And now we will continue facing strong teams. This, without a doubt, will help us to continue evolving, growing and being stimulated at a level that we hope for the team to continue to be a protagonist in the main competitions.”
